After the battle that ended the major threat of the Hive Fleet Kraken, there was a battle for Baey, as one of the "splinter fleets" from Kraken found its way to that world. Several chapters, including the 2nd Founding Chapters of the Revilers, Angels Vermillion, and the Imperial Fists of the First Founding, came to their aid.
Baey has been a prosperous trading world, and the loss of such an important hub of commerce for that area of the Imperium would cripple the economy of the entire area. So, when the Tyranids were first detected on their inbound trajectory, a distress call went out, and the Space Marines sent in their closest chapters to defend the world. They arrived just in time to be able to, in their minds, hopefully stave off any major damage. To their surprise, the Tyranids were more numerous than initial reports had indicated, and the battle was more intense than anyone had anticipated!
Even though the Tyranids gained large amounts of ground during the initial fighting, they remained confined to one continent. That continent housed the majority of the military power for the world, which is why the Tyranids landed there, but was sparsely populated otherwise.
After a fierce spat of fighting, a group of marines was cut off from their respective chapters, mainly from the Revilers, Angels Vermillion, and the Imperial Fists. Their numbers were rather limited (some reports had them at no more than 30 in number), and they had no support in the way armor. So, to the Tyranid Hive Mind, they were a minimal threat. They were pinned back, and then thoroughly ignored while the hordes of aliens pushed against the main fighting force, other than a small group meant to keep them from the fighting.
This small group of Marines were able to fend off the almost second thought assaults without any major casualties. A sergeant from the Imperial Fists, Ocoa Lamond, took command of the group since he was the highest rank. There was a Imperial Fist chaplain with them, and he was adament that this ragtag group of marines should form an assault and push into the heart of the Tyranid force. "The Emperor will protect us, and we will be his Spear that will be thrust into the heart of this Xenos incursion!!". With this, Sergeant Lamond worked the Marines into a zealous fervor, with the further help of the chaplain, preparing for the thrust. During this time, Lamond even took some time to fashion a spear from his power sword and some other materials that were handy, so that his Marines had a visual representation of the fighting that was to come to focus on.
At one point, the Tyranid force containing them seemed a little thinner than it had been, and Sergeant Lamond decided he was going to take a risk and blast his way out of where they were pinned. Such was the fervor that the Imperial Fist Sergeant had for defeating the aliens that he led the Marines out of their cover! After several days of fighting, they happened upon a group of aliens that were on their way to reinforce the front lines against the main Marine battle force. Among those reinforcements was a Carnifex. Since the Hive Mind was preoccupied with the main Marine battle contingent, the Carnifex was caught off guard, and with the combined firepower of a Lascannon and Plasma cannon devastator, the small group was able to fell the mighty Tyranid! After the creature collapsed, Lamond approached the beast, and plunged his spear into its eye, as a symbol of his zeal for the Emperor.
His men were further inspired, and they pushed harder against the center of the Tyranid force. Since the reinforcing Carnifex was eliminated before it could join the main battle, the Marine battle force was able to fight its way towards them, and they eventually were able to rejoin forces and defeat the Tyranids. When all was said and done, Lamond met up with the rest of the Marines with 25 of his original 30, meaning during the entire battle after they were separated, Lamond only lost 5 Marines! Since the rest of the force sustained close to 40% casualties, Lamond was seen to have the protection of the Emperor, and was deemed one of his Champions. The planet of Baey was saved from disaster, and the economy of the sector was saved from collapse.
After the battle, Lamond attempted to bring his entire group into the fold of the Imperial Fists, since he now considered all of them part of his command. The Imperial Fists refused, as they did not believe that the Revilers and Angels were fitting to be Fists, and his own men refused to join the Fists as well. The Chapter Master of the Imperial Fists attempted to force Lamond and his Fist men to rejoin the Chapter without the others, since it would make the Fists all the more influential to have another Champion in their midst, but Lamond decided to demand that he be left on Baey with his men so that there was a military presence in case of another splinter fleet of Tyranids decided to show up. The Imperial Fists agreed, and so Lamond was left on Baey. The chaplain that helped to inspire them during the battle was so inspired, himself, by their deeds that he also decided to stay as well.
After a short period of time, Lamond changed the colors that he and his men wore to a combination of the colors that they each wore, to include Red, Grey and Black. He had a large citadel built on the continent where the fighting had occurred to be their bastion. Even though he was not recruiting, men streamed to the citadel and the number of Marines increased.
Upon hearing that there were Marines that were not organized by a Chapter that were increasing in number, the Emperor send an emissary to Lamond to ascertain whether they were Heretical or not, even though the story of Lamond had even reached the Emperors ear. When the emissary arrived, he was in awe at the devotion that Lamond and his men gave to the Emperor, and he declared Lamond Chapter Master and that the Marines on Baey were a new Chapter. When asked what name Lamond wanted for his Chapter, he declared them to be the "Sanguine Spears".
Over the numerous battles through the years after the formation, most Chapters still do not officially recognize the Spears as a Chapter. But, whenever in battle alongside of their brothers, those who fight with them are impressed with the zealous dedication that they have to the Emperor and the Imperium. So much so that the Sanguine Spears have almost 3 times the normal percentage of chaplains compared to other Chapters! Quite a few chaplains have defected from their chapters because they see how dedicated the Spears are, feeling that their service to the Emperor would be greater if they were fighting alongside of the Spears!
